In any case, you’ll just need to access the “Play Locally” option when speaking with Senri the Mailman Palico. It’s obviously easiest for everyone to be playing in handheld mode when they’re sharing a room, but it should be possible to use multiple TVs if you have that set-up available. While local co-op play is technically possible, accessing it will require each person to have their own Nintendo Switch.
